Rajasthan: Dalit bus driver was beaten to death on just this matter
In the dark of night, the bus collided with the bench kept outside the sweet shop. Started beating after asking caste, died.

Jaipur. New cases of Dalit atrocities are continuously coming to the fore in the state. Dalits are being killed here sometimes for riding a mare and sometimes for having a moustache. In one case, a case of death of an innocent student by beating for touching a pot of water has also come to the fore. Now the latest case of Dalit murder has come to the fore from Pali district. Where the Dalit bus driver unknowingly overturned the bus in the dark of night and the bus collided with the seating bench kept in front of the hotel. On the unwanted mistake of the bus driver, the accused first asked the bus driver his name and caste. As soon as the bus driver mentioned his caste as Meghwal by name, the hotel owner started humiliating him on the basis of caste. After this, along with his brother-in-law, son and hotel workers, he was beaten to death. On information, the police reached the spot, took the dead body in possession and reached the community health center of Nadol.
In this regard, Gundoj, a resident of the deceased’s uncle Rugram Meghwal, has registered a case of murder against Sawai Singh, a sweet shop owner of Nadol, his brother-in-law, son Rudraksh, hotel workers Bittu, Ghevar Devasi and others at Rani police station.
Demand for the arrest of the accused, did not allow postmortem
As soon as the news of the murder of Dalit bus driver Govind spread, a crowd of Bhim Army and Azad Samaj Party office bearers along with other Bahujan organizations gathered in Nadol town. When the police started the post-mortem action on Sunday, the relatives protested and demanded to arrest the accused of murder first, due to which the hands and legs of the police swelled. Circle officer Bali Achal Singh, police station officer Mahendra Singh reached the spot of the police raid. While the family members were consulted for the post-mortem, but the uncle of the deceased, Rugaram, asked to do the post-mortem only after the arrest of the accused.

Rani police station officer Singh Khinchi told The Mooknayak that “after the death of Govind, his uncle Gundoj, a resident of Rugaram, gave a report that his nephew Govind was a bus driver. Was taking the bus back. Then unknowingly the bus hit the seating bench outside the nearby Jodhpur Sweets sweet shop. On this the hotel owner Sawai Singh started abusing Prarthi’s nephew. The accused shop owner asked him about his name and caste. On telling Meghwal with his name, the accused insulted him by using caste-specific words. Along with this, the accused, along with his brother-in-law, his son Rudraksh, hotel workers Bittu, Ghevar Devasi, etc., made a murderous attack on Govind. done.”
“During this time, some people intervened. On this, the accused chased away the people who came to save Govind. And again started fighting with Govind. Govind died due to serious injuries in the fight. Later, the accused fled leaving the body on the road”, the SHO said, registering a case of murder and handing over the investigation to Bali Circle Officer Anchal Singh.
Bali Circle Officer Anchal Singh, who is probing the Govind Meghwal murder case, said that a case has been registered at Rani police station for the murder of bus driver Govind Meghwal in Nadol. “I am investigating the matter. The post-mortem of the dead body has not been done yet. We are discussing with the family members for the post-mortem with the people of the social organization. Can’t say anything before the investigation. The dead body is kept in Nadol’s government hospital. Is.”
